Heya,

I haven't any experience making Chaosy Necrons, but I do convert necrons and chaos into my orks. To create Chaosy - crony - Orks!

So is it possible? hell yeh! Nurgle would have been easier (but that's just because nurgle is like the easiest converting the world has ever seen). For daemonkin, you could very easily turn your barge into stuff like the soul grinders etc...

So how about a brainstorm to start off? (assuming you actually like to play the game also)
Khorne fleshhounds are a good unit, you could sculpt some necrons into dog shapes - Torso's become ribcages placed horizontally, you can snip arm joints to place the arms into a more traditional 4 legged pose, then maybe sculpt the face? placing a scarab in the head/brain area to help indicate its robotically controlled?

Bloodthirster, giant robot bloodthirster, using a tomb blade you could use the cresent shape to create the head of an axe or something

If its any help, there used to be these guys in the old 40k predessesor, Space Crusade.

http://wh40k.lexicanum.com/wiki/File:Chaos_Androids.jpg

They were android bodies with deamons bound inside them (by chaos squats, I seem to remember) - their design was later used to inspire the necrons.
